Dell Technologies is extending support for Dell EMC CloudIQ, a cloud application that serves as the first step toward self-contained infrastructure.
The initiative is part of a larger attempt to develop self-contained operations, which began with CloudIQ, which includes AIOps capabilities for managing issues before they become serious. Dell Technologies announced the Apex portfolio as a service endeavor and detailed objectives for 2020. Dell, like Cisco and HPE, sees recurring revenue, finance, and as-a-service solutions as key to its future success. The measure is expected to hasten data center and infrastructure automation.
Dell Technologies will introduce Dell EMC CloudIQ during a Mark Hamill-hosted Autonomous Operations event.
